Verse (16:32), Word 2 - Quranic Grammar

__

The second word of verse (16:32) is divided into 2 morphological segments. A verb and object pronoun. The form V imperfect verb (فعل مضارع) is third person feminine singular and is in the indicative mood (مرفوع). The verb's triliteral root is wāw fā yā (و ف ي). The attached object pronoun is third person masculine plural.

Verse (16:32)

The analysis above refers to the 32nd verse of chapter 16 (sūrat l-naḥl):

Sahih International: The ones whom the angels take in death, [being] good and pure; [the angels] will say, "Peace be upon you. Enter Paradise for what you used to do."
